DOTr Announces 12 Days of Free Rides for the Holidays

The Department of Transportation announced it will be giving free rides through the MRT and LRT beginning December 14 for passengers

The Christmas season is officially in full swing—parties everywhere, reunions left and right, and kids counting down the days until their break. But as any parent or commuter knows, the holidays also mean one thing: traffic that tests everyone’s patience.

Understanding just how challenging it has become to move around the metro, the Department of Transportation (DOTr) has rolled out a welcome surprise for Filipino commuters. Beginning December 14, the agency is offering 12 days of free rides across MRT-3, LRT-1, and LRT-2—perfectly timed for the busiest weeks of the year.

12 Days of Christmas Free Rides

In its announcement, the DOTr shared that the free rides will run from December 14 to 25, with each day dedicated to a specific sector. Here’s the complete schedule:

  • December 14 – Senior Citizens
  • December 15 – Students
  • December 16 – OFWs and their families
  • December 17 – Teachers and Health Workers
  • December 18 – Persons with Disabilities (PWDs) and male passengers
  • December 19 – Government Employees
  • December 20 – Female Passengers
  • December 21 – Families (no limit on number of members)
  • December 22 – Solo Parents and LGBTQIA+ members
  • December 23 – Private Sector Employees and Household Helpers
  • December 24 – Uniformed Personnel, Veterans, and their families
  • December 25 – All Commuters

The initiative follows President Bongbong Marcos’ directive to ensure smoother, safer, and more efficient travel for Filipinos during the holiday rush.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

This is a holiday initiative by the DOTr offering free MRT-3, LRT-1, and LRT-2 rides from December 14 to 25. Each day highlights and prioritizes a specific commuter group—from students and solo parents to senior citizens and families.

The free rides cover the following:
MRT-3
LRT-1
LRT-2
No tickets or beep card deductions will be required on designated days.

Since these rides fall during the peak holiday rush, expect bigger crowds, especially on days featuring families, OFWs, and workers. To make the trip smoother with kids:
Travel early
Bring water and small snacks
Keep kids close and brief them before boarding
